Sticking, Rubbing, and Sagging Door Repair

Sticking, rubbing, and sagging door repair addresses doors in Florissant homes that no longer operate cleanly after years of use, flooring or trim changes, or minor jamb movement.

Work checks hinge fastening, jamb alignment, reveals, and whether the door is rubbing the frame or floor, then determines whether hinge adjustment, jamb repair, or planing and refitting is appropriate.

The outcome is restored operation where the existing door and jamb remain serviceable, or a clear replacement recommendation when the damage is too extensive to repair.

Jamb, Strike, and Latch Repair

Jamb, strike, and latch repair covers damaged jamb material, loose strike areas, and latch alignment problems in Florissant doors where the latch no longer engages consistently.

Work checks the strike plate position, latch engagement, jamb condition, and hinge side, then repairs or repositions the strike, replaces damaged jamb material, and shims for alignment as needed.

The outcome is a door that latches cleanly without lifting or pushing, with the strike and jamb sound enough to hold the hardware reliably.

Door Casing and Trim Repair

Door casing and trim repair covers split, dented, or damaged casing around Florissant doors where the trim has been bumped, split, or altered over time.

Work removes damaged casing, replaces it with matching or closely coordinated profile, fits miter and cope joints, and finishes paint-grade or stain-grade trim to integrate with the existing opening.

The outcome is a clean, finished door opening with consistent reveals and trim that reads as intentional rather than patched.

Common Door Problems in Florissant Properties

Doors Rub or Stick After Flooring or Trim Changes

New flooring heights and trim changes in Florissant homes commonly leave doors rubbing the floor or frame. The door and jamb are evaluated to determine whether adjustment or refitting restores clean operation.

Hinges or Jamb Areas Become Loose or Damaged

Years of use loosen hinge screws, wear hinge mortises, and damage jamb material around the strike. Loose hinges and split jamb wood are repaired or reinforced so the door hangs properly.

Latch and Strike Alignment Becomes Unreliable

When a door shifts, the latch and strike no longer line up and the door only latches if lifted or pushed. The strike position and jamb condition are corrected so the latch engages consistently.

How Much Does Door Repair Cost in Florissant?

These are typical market planning ranges, not binding quotes. Actual pricing depends on the scope, materials, dimensions, access, existing conditions, and finish level of your specific project.

Door Repair

Basic adjustment or minor hardware/jamb repair: roughly $150 to $400+
Notes: hinge, strike, jamb, and labor affect cost.
More involved door/jamb repair: roughly $300 to $800+
Notes: split material, trim replacement, hardware, and opening condition affect scope.
Replacement instead of repair: typically $400 to $1,500+ per opening
Notes: door type, jamb, trim, hardware, and exterior conditions affect price.

Can a sticking door usually be repaired?

Yes, many sticking doors can be repaired when the existing door and jamb remain serviceable, by correcting hinges, jamb alignment, or the rub point. Severe damage or deformation may make replacement the better value, and that is evaluated before work begins.

Can you repair a split door jamb?

Yes, a split door jamb can often be repaired by reinforcing or replacing the damaged jamb material, depending on the extent of the split and the condition of the surrounding wood. Severe damage may require jamb section replacement.

Why does a door stop latching correctly?

A door stops latching correctly when the latch and strike no longer align, usually because the door has shifted, hinges have loosened, or the jamb has moved. The strike position and jamb condition are corrected so the latch engages consistently.

When is door replacement better than repair?

Door replacement is better than repair when the door slab, jamb, or hardware are too damaged or deformed to restore reliable operation. The condition is evaluated before work begins so the right value is chosen rather than defaulting to replacement.
